The image of the regular hexagon coincides with the pre-image 6 times during rotation.
A regular hexagon is a polygon that has six equal sides and six equal angles.
In a single rotation which is usually the rotation of an object at 360°, the number of times in which the regular hexagon coincides with its pre-image is 6 times, this is because it has 6 equal sides and 6 equal angles.
